Peripheral effects Via the AMY2 and AMY3 receptors Cagrilintide acts peripherally: Slowing of gastric emptying , stronger than with GLP-1 Suppression of postprandial glucagon , helps control postprandial glycemic spikes Modulation of bone remodeling (via AMY3), a neutral effect, but clinically monitored Synergy with GLP-1 (the mechanistic basis of CagriSema) The main innovation is the complementarity with the GLP-1 pathway : GLP-1 suppresses appetite via the arcuate nucleus of the hypothalamus (POMC neurons, AgRP/NPY inhibition) Amylin suppresses appetite via the area postrema (CGRP-like neurons) Two independent centers, two independent mechanisms

HUBERMAN: In order to find out the lethal dose of something, as you can imagine, unfortunately, the way these studies are done is they give animals more and more, that is higher and higher doses of a given compound, find out at what point about 50% of the population of those animals starts to die, and then that's the so-called LD50, or at least that's one crude way of describing it
